Set the Basics First

Start with the fields that shape the rest of the product:

Field Why it matters
Railroad or layout name Appears in reports, operating context, and places where the app identifies your railroad.
Primary scale Helps with inventory defaults and model railroad context.
Era or time period Helps Casey, recognition, and operating guidance stay aligned with your prototype or freelanced setting.
Prototype road or theme Useful when you model a real railroad, region, industry, or freelanced concept.
Layout status Helps distinguish a working layout, a collection, a club railroad, a museum setting, or a railroad still in planning.

For beta testing, enter real but non-sensitive details. Avoid putting private addresses, access codes, or personal notes into public-facing fields.

How Other Features Use This Profile

The railroad profile supports several product areas:

  • Asset Management can use scale, era, and railroad context when you add or review items.
  • Casey can answer product and railroad questions with better context.
  • RailCommand can align layout, operations, hardware, and session setup with the selected railroad.
  • Reports can include the correct railroad identity and collection context.
  • RSP-U can make onboarding and role training easier to connect to your real use case.
